Before you go blue-black, be sure you're ready to commit—because it is a commitment. "Whether glossing or going permanently blue-black, this color stains and is very hard to get out," Rez shares. "If you are not sure you want to commit long term, gloss or do a demi-permanent blue-black. That's easier to remove." L’Oréal’s Colorista temporary hair dye spray is your best bet, and it works on natural, bleached or unbleached hair of any shade. Use it to create blue streaks and highlights throughout your hair, then simply wash it out in the shower. Mind you, application is a bit messy — so it’s best to drape a towel over your shoulders while applying. In fact, it often looks more pronounced and vibrant on naturally dark hair. However, for those with very dark hair, some pre-lightening or bleaching might be necessary to achieve a more intense blue black shade.
